How does data analysis intersect with urban art?

Data analysis supports urban art by quantifying audience engagement, mapping installations, and assessing social impact. Analysts work with geolocation, foot-traffic, social media mentions, and survey data to help curators and cultural planners understand which works resonate with communities. For example, time-series and heatmap visualizations can reveal peak visitation patterns, while sentiment analysis of public comments can inform future commissions. Analysts in this space often collaborate with artists, municipal cultural departments, and civic tech groups to translate qualitative feedback into actionable insights.

What roles exist in ecology data work?

In ecology-focused data roles, analysts manage biodiversity datasets, remote-sensing imagery, and environmental monitoring stations. Typical responsibilities include cleaning sensor data, running statistical models, and producing maps that highlight habitat change or pollution hotspots. Employers range from research institutions and NGOs to government environmental agencies and consultancy firms providing data to conservation projects. Practical skills often emphasize spatial analysis, familiarity with environmental datasets, and reproducible workflows to ensure findings are reliable and transparent.

What core skills define data analysis roles?

Core skills for data analyst jobs include data cleaning, exploratory analysis, visualization, and basic statistical modeling. Proficiency in tools such as Python, R, SQL, and GIS software is widely useful, alongside strong communication skills to present findings to non-technical stakeholders. Domain knowledge—whether in urban planning, ecology, or arts administration—adds value by helping analysts frame questions and select appropriate metrics. Equally important are ethical practices: ensuring data privacy, reducing bias in models, and documenting analysis for reproducibility.

How do analysts support sustainability projects?

Analysts support sustainability by measuring resource flows, emissions, and project outcomes to guide policy and investment decisions. Tasks can include creating dashboards that show progress toward sustainability goals, running scenario models for energy use, and evaluating the effectiveness of interventions like green infrastructure. Collaboration with engineers, policymakers, and community groups helps turn data into practical recommendations. Success in sustainability roles often hinges on integrating disparate datasets—energy, transport, waste, and demographic—to create a clear performance story.

Where can city-level analysts find local services and collaborators?

City-level analysts often partner with a mix of local services: municipal planning departments, public works, transit agencies, cultural offices, and community organizations. Opportunities also arise through civic tech groups, research labs, and consultancies that contract with city governments. To connect with potential collaborators, analysts can contribute to open data portals, participate in local hackathons, or volunteer on community research projects that publish findings.
